Ignition Change

The ignition switch is the most important element of your vehicle's charging and starting systems. They activate these systems when the ignition key is inserted, and also supply the power to other electronic components. The vehicle may not run or start if the ignition switch is broken. You can either purchase an ignition switch from your dealer or repair shop or repair it yourself. It's a challenging task and you must consult your owner's manual or service manual for directions.

You should disconnect the battery prior to beginning to avoid cutting yourself or damaging the electronic components in your car. Depending on your model, the ignition switch may be bolted to the dashboard or have lock tabs that need pressing. Follow your repair manual to remove the dash cover and gain access to the ignition cylinder. Install the new cylinder wafer in the place of the old one. It is now time to reassemble the steering wheel and dash, and then reconnect the battery.

Check to determine if the transmission is in Park. Try another key to see whether it engages the starter. You can also buy an additional key fob but it must be programmed and activated in the vehicle to work.

Lost Car Keys

In the past, losing car keys wasn't a big problem because you could easily obtain a spare key and keep it in a safe location. However, as cars have become more technologically advanced, they've also developed more sophisticated security systems and replacing a lost key can cost more than ever.

You might require a replacement key from a locksmith or dealer depending on the kind of key that you have. Modern keys come with transponder chips that need to be programmed for the car you own. This process is quite complex and requires a specialist locksmith for your car or the dealership.

If you own a traditional double-edged key for your car, you can replace it with a spare car key at any hardware store for around $10. The best solution is to call an automotive locksmith, who will create a new key without your old one. They may even come to your location and do it on the spot. You will need to show evidence of ownership, such as the title or registration of your vehicle.

Make sure you've got everything in case you lose your car key. Check your pockets, purse jacket, coat and other items you may have been carrying. If you're unable to locate them Try to calm yourself and retrace your steps. If you're not able to locate them, contact the police department and file a complaint about the loss.

Remote Entry System

The remote entry system lets you to lock or unlock your doors and open or close the trunk and the sunroof without having to touch your car keys. The system allows you to remotely start your vehicle which makes it more convenient and secure.

The system transmits radio frequency signals to receiver modules that manage the various functions of your vehicle. If your remote key fob isn't working suddenly, it may indicate that the receiver modules have deteriorated. To determine this problem, an OBD scan tool can be used to determine the root cause of the issue.

If your remote key fob still doesn't work it is possible to replace the battery. Make sure to use the same size and voltage as the old one. A dead battery for your coin is the most frequent reason for keys not to work. It is possible to replace it with less than $10.
